[Checkins] SVN: zope.app.catalog/trunk/ Change catalog's addMenuItem permission to zope.ManageServices, because that makes more sense. See CHANGES.txt.

Dan Korostelev nadako at gmail.com
Sun Jan 11 12:24:10 EST 2009


Log message for revision 94690:
  Change catalog's addMenuItem permission to zope.ManageServices, because that makes more sense. See CHANGES.txt.

Changed:
  U   zope.app.catalog/trunk/CHANGES.txt
  U   zope.app.catalog/trunk/src/zope/app/catalog/browser/configure.zcml

-=-
Modified: zope.app.catalog/trunk/CHANGES.txt
===================================================================
--- zope.app.catalog/trunk/CHANGES.txt	2009-01-11 02:39:00 UTC (rev 94689)
+++ zope.app.catalog/trunk/CHANGES.txt	2009-01-11 17:24:09 UTC (rev 94690)
@@ -5,7 +5,10 @@
 3.6.1 (unreleased)
 ------------------
 
-- ...
+- Change catalog's addMenuItem permission to zope.ManageServices
+  as it doesn't make any sense to add an empty catalog that you
+  can't modify with zope.ManageContent permission and it's completely
+  useless without indexes. So there's no need to show a menu item.
 
 3.6.0 (2009-01-03)
 ------------------

Modified: zope.app.catalog/trunk/src/zope/app/catalog/browser/configure.zcml
===================================================================
--- zope.app.catalog/trunk/src/zope/app/catalog/browser/configure.zcml	2009-01-11 02:39:00 UTC (rev 94689)
+++ zope.app.catalog/trunk/src/zope/app/catalog/browser/configure.zcml	2009-01-11 17:24:09 UTC (rev 94690)
@@ -9,7 +9,7 @@
     title="Catalog"
     description="A Catalog allows indexing and searching of objects"
     class="zope.app.catalog.catalog.Catalog"
-    permission="zope.ManageContent"
+    permission="zope.ManageServices"
     />
 
 <icon



More information about the Checkins mailing list